Physical Address
304 North Cardinal St.
Dorchester Center, MA 02124
Physical Address
304 North Cardinal St.
Dorchester Center, MA 02124


Nine out of ten web servers run Linux. That’s not an opinion — it’s a market share fact.
Disclosure: This post contains affiliate links. If you make a purchase through these links, I may earn a small commission at no extra cost to you.
![]()
![]()
Photo by Christina Morillo — Pexels
Nine out of ten web servers run Linux. That’s not an opinion — it’s a market share fact. But Windows hosting exists for a reason, and for certain use cases, it’s the only option that works. If you’re building with ASP.NET, using MSSQL databases, or running Microsoft-specific applications, Windows hosting is what you need.
For everyone else? Linux hosting is almost certainly the better choice. Let me explain why, and cover the exceptions.
What runs on Linux hosting:
Basically, if your website uses PHP and MySQL (which covers 80%+ of all websites), Linux hosting is what you want. It’s also generally cheaper because Linux is open-source — no licensing fees for the operating system.
Advantages:
What requires Windows hosting:
Advantages:
![]()
![]()
Photo by Brett Sayles — Pexels
| Feature | Linux Hosting | Windows Hosting |
|---|---|---|
| Cost | Cheaper (no OS license) | 10-20% more expensive |
| CMS Support | WordPress, Joomla, all major CMS | Can run WordPress but less common |
| Programming | PHP, Python, Ruby, Node.js | ASP.NET, C#, VB.NET (+ PHP) |
| Database | MySQL, MariaDB, PostgreSQL | MSSQL, MySQL, Access |
| Control Panel | cPanel, Plesk | Plesk, IIS Manager |
| Stability | Excellent | Good (requires more maintenance) |
| Community | Massive | Smaller for web hosting |
| Market Share | ~90% of web servers | ~10% of web servers |
Choose Linux if:
Choose Windows if:
For the vast majority of website owners reading this — bloggers, small businesses, ecommerce stores — Linux hosting is the answer. Providers like Hosting.com and InterServer offer excellent Linux hosting with cPanel, one-click WordPress installation, and everything you need. Check our cheap hosting roundup for more Linux hosting options.
Need Windows hosting specifically? InterServer offers Windows VPS plans with Plesk and full .NET support.
Technically yes — WordPress supports both Linux and Windows. But it runs better on Linux (it was built for the LAMP stack), and nearly all WordPress hosting plans use Linux. There’s no benefit to running WordPress on Windows hosting. See our WordPress hosting guide.
Neither is inherently more secure — security depends on configuration, updates, and practices. Linux has a longer track record in the web server space and a larger security community, which means vulnerabilities tend to get patched faster.
If your application is PHP-based, switching is straightforward — just migrate your files and database. If you’re running ASP.NET, you’d need to rewrite your application for a cross-platform framework like ASP.NET Core. Our migration guide covers the hosting switch process.
Unless you specifically need .NET or MSSQL, go with Linux hosting. It’s cheaper, faster for web applications, has more hosting options, and runs the software stack that 90% of the internet relies on. That’s not bias — it’s just the most practical choice for web hosting in 2026.